Smart Appliances: Gone are the days of traditional stovetops and ovens. With the rise of industrial automation, smart appliances have taken center stage in modern kitchens. These appliances, equipped with sensors and connectivity features, can be controlled remotely through smartphone apps or voice assistants. Imagine preheating your oven or starting your coffee maker before even stepping foot in the kitchen. Smart appliances offer a whole new level of convenience and efficiency. 2. Automated Cooking: One of the most significant advancements in industrial automation is the concept of automated cooking. An automated kitchen system can handle various cooking processes, from measuring ingredients to precise cooking times. It eliminates guesswork and human errors, ensuring consistently delicious results. With programmable recipes and precise temperature control, even novice cooks can create gourmet meals effortlessly. 3. Connected Appliances and IoT: Industrial automation has enabled appliances to communicate with each other and form a connected kitchen ecosystem. This Internet of Things (IoT) integration allows appliances to share data, adjust settings based on usage patterns, and even order ingredients when supplies are running low. Through interconnected devices, the kitchen becomes a hub of efficiency, making sure everything runs smoothly. 4. Enhanced Safety and Energy Efficiency: Industrial automation in modern kitchens also prioritizes safety and energy efficiency. Smart appliances incorporate safety features like auto-shutoff and alarms to prevent accidents like fires or gas leaks. Furthermore, they are designed to optimize energy consumption, reducing wastage and lowering utility bills. With automated sensors, appliances can adjust settings based on usage, optimizing efficiency without compromising performance. 5.
